摘要

A calcium chloride-oxygen leaching procedure and metal-recovery method for treating an arsenical Cu-Co sulfide concentrate was developed by the Bureau of Mines as an alternative to smelting. The procedure involved leaching in a calcium chloride solution with CaCO3 for 96 h at 26 pct solids (concentrate and CaCO3), 115 C, and a pressure of 50 psig (345 kPa) with oxygen. More than 98 pct of the cobalt and 97 pct of the copper were extracted, and 99.98 pct of the arsenic and 99.9 pct of the iron remained in the leached residue.
